Everyone who's ever used a Commodore 64 knows the standard greeting of "COMMODORE 64 BASIC V2 64K RAM SYSTEM 38911 BASIC BYTES FREE". However, I've seen an upgraded version of BASIC for the C64 floating around somewhere on the Internet. Can someone point me in the right direction as to where I might find it?

I may recommend TSB - Tuned Simon's BASIC - faster and without all the bugs from the original SB.
